Trim stems and discolored parts. Soak in cold water for 10 minutes to remove dirt. Wash in clean water. Step 2 - Cut larger mushrooms. Leave small mushrooms whole; cut large ones. Step 3 - Cook for 5 minutes. Cover with water in a saucepan and boil 5 minutes. Step 4 - Fill the jars. rea farm apartmentsWebBring to a boil and then reduce heat to a simmer for 5 minutes. Drain.
